Raphael (CC-2) color belongs to the Red color family (hue). The hexadecimal color code(color number) for Raphael (CC-2) is #583835, and the RGB color code is RGB(88, 56, 53).
In the RGB color model, Raphael (CC-2) has a red value of 88, a green value of 56, and a blue value of 53.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 36.4% magenta, 39.8% yellow, and 65.5%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 5.1° (degrees), 24.8 % saturation, and 27.6 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, Raphael (CC-2) has a hue of 5.1° (degrees), 39.8 % saturation and 34.5 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of Raphael (CC-2)?
Raphael (CC-2) has an LRV of nearly 5. By LRV value, it is a d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V) is a measure of how much visible light is reflected off a surface. It is a number on a scale of 0 to 100, with 0 being pure black and 100 being pure white. The higher the LRV, the more light the color reflects and the lighter it will appear.

LRV is important to consider when choosing paint colors for a room, as it can affect the overall brightness and mood of the space.
Lighter colors with higher LRVs will make a room feel more spacious and airy, while darker colors with lower LRVs will create a more intimate and cozy atmosphere.
